ESI rolls over rebar, high stocks concern traders

Emirates Steel has rolled over its rebar price from April at AED 2,735/tonne ($745) ex-mill on letter of credit 90 days for May rolling. United Arab Emirates traders lost almost 15 working days in April due to the long Eid holiday and flood-related disruption, including road blockades, and construction sites and warehouses being covered with water. Almost all mills, including the UAE benchmark mill, could deliver only 35-45% of rebar orders for April deliveries. …
